Edward Griswold 1607–1690 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: 26 July 1607

Birth Location: Kenilworth, Warwickshire, England

Death Date: 30 August 1690

Death Location: Clinton, Middlesex County, Connecticut, USA

Father: George Griswold

Mother: Dousabel Leigh

Spouse(s): Margaret Hicks

Children(s): Deborah Griswold

In 1607, Edward Griswold entered the world in Kenilworth, Warwickshire, England, born to George Griswold And Dousabel Leigh. Edward Griswold married Margaret Hicks, and had children including Deborah Griswold. Edward Griswold passed away in 1690 in Clinton, Middlesex County, Connecticut, USA.
